Summary Our law firm is seeking to hire an immigration attorney who will be an exceptional addition to our team. As an immigration associate attorney, you will be responsible for managing a caseload of removal (deportation) defense, family-based & humanitarian immigration cases. You will represent clients, many of whom are detained by ICE, in their immigration court cases and also in their appeals. You will bring a number of skills to this job, including (a) strong written and oral advocacy; (b) effective client and caseload management; (c) disciplined adherence to best practices; and (d) commitment to exercising leadership and improving the performance of our team. What You'll Do Manage a caseload of removal defense cases in the Phoenix, Florence, and Eloy Immigration Courts, in addition to managing a caseload of affirmative applications pending before USCIS and the Department of State. Prepare and litigate applications for relief from removal, including cancellation of removal, adjustment of status, asylum, withholding of removal, Convention Against Torture (CAT), and other waivers Prepare and argue motions to release our clients from detention in bond proceedings Challenge allegations of removability through motions to terminate and motions to suppress Conduct investigations and discovery to effectively support our clients' claims with persuasive evidence Work closely with clients and their families to prepare affirmative applications for visas, citizenship, asylum, U visas, T visas, and visas under the Violence Against Women Act (VAWA), in addition to waiver of inadmissibility Effectively communicate with other attorneys and experts in the field-locally and nationally-to leverage as much knowledge and advice as possible for the benefit of our clients Legal research and writing--specifically, drafting and filing motions and briefs before the immigration courts, Board of Immigration Appeals (BIA), and U.S. Court of Appeals for the Ninth Circuit Analyze the immigration consequences of criminal convictions by providing “Padilla consults” to criminal defense attorneys Litigate petitions for writ of habeas corpus and applications for preliminary injunctive relief in the U.S. District Court Perform consultations for potential clients who are interested in the law firm's services Compensation and Benefits We offer a competitive compensation and benefit package that compares to the top-rated immigration law firms across the country, which includes: Monthly and quarterly performance-based bonuses that allow attorneys to earn significantly more than their base salary Paid Time Off (PTO), accrued biweekly Five (5) days sick time Minimum thirteen (13) days vacation time with opportunity to accrue additional vacation/personal leave each year Eleven (11) paid holidays Health, dental, vision, and life insurance Retirement plan Payment of bar and professional organization membership dues Payment of annual MCLE courses - additional paid professional development opportunities Mileage reimbursement for travel between offices and places of work Relocation assistance for out-of-state new hires Attorneys who choose to continue their careers with our law firm are considered for promotion along a partnership track, which offers additional opportunities and compensation What You'll Bring Juris Doctor from an accredited law school Must be licensed to practice law by the highest court of any state All qualified applicants, including recent graduates, will be considered Proficiency in Spanish is preferred but not required Must have reliable transportation with a valid driver's license and insurance And, most importantly, a commitment to our mission and values

How much does a law clerk earn in Scottsdale, AZ?

The average law clerk in Scottsdale, AZ earns between $27,000 and $91,000 annually. This compares to the national average law clerk range of $27,000 to $114,000.

Average law clerk salary in Scottsdale, AZ

$50,000
